#f55058 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#f55058 is composed of 96.1% red, 31.4%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 67.3% magenta, 64.1% yellow and 3.9% black. It has a hue angle of 357.1 degrees, a saturation of 89.2% and a lightness of 63.7%. #f55058 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ffa0b0 with #eb0000. Closest websafe color is: #ff6666.

#f55058 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#f55058 has RGB values of R:245, G:80, B:88 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.67, Y:0.64, K:0.04. Its decimal value is 16076888.
